what is the base if the rate is 16.4% and the portion is 457?​

Respuesta :

palazzolorachel palazzolorachel
  • 01-03-2022

Answer:

[tex]\frac{114250}{41}[/tex]

Alternative Forms: [tex]2786.\overline{58536},2786\frac{24}{41},\approx2.786585\times{10}^3[/tex]

(Step-by-step explanation)

[tex]457\div16.4%[/tex]%

Calculate

[tex]\frac{457}{0.164}[/tex]

Multiply both the numerator and denominator with the same integer

[tex]\frac{457000}{164}[/tex]

Cross out the common factor

[tex]\frac{114250}{41}[/tex]
